On 30 Mar, 22:21, [EMAIL PROTECTED] wrote: > Hello everybody, > > I'm building a python module to do some heavy computation in C (for > dynamic time warp distance computation).
Why don't you just ctypes and NumPy arrays instead? # double timewarp(double x[], int lenx, double y[], int leny); import numpy import ctypes from numpy.ctypeslib import ndpointer from ctypes import c_int _timewarp = ctypes.cdll.timewarp.timewarp # timewarp.dll array_pointer_t = ndpointer(dtype=double) _timewarp.argtypes = [array_pointer_t, c_int, array_pointer_t, c_int] def timewarp(x, y): lenx, leny = x.shape[0], y.shape[0] return _timewarp(x, lenx, y, leny) -- http://mail.python.org/mailman/listinfo/python-list
